Next steps in the campaign to stop the use of 0844 numbers in our Health Service

September 6, 2007 9:02 PM

At last night's Council meeting, Liberal Democrat Councillor Julia Roberts asked that if, when the discussion on funding for a new hospital took place, consideration would be given to ensuring that the telephone number would not be a premium rate telephone number, like the new 0844 one for the University of North Tees and Hartlepool.

This would ensure that those residents ringing the hospital would have "More services provided locally that were easily accessible".

Note to Editors:

The current hospital has recently changed telephone number and is now using an 0844 number. These calls are charged at 6p per minute from a BT landline and up to 40p per minute from some mobiles. They are not included in any free call plans that residents may have with their telephone providers.

Further, the number cannot be dialled from some overseas countries so a patient or hospital abroad who needs access to medical records in this country has to use the even more expensive 087 number, as do any friends or relatives who want to enquire about the health of patients in this country. That does not make services "easily accessible".

Each telephone call received by the hospital using this telephone number generates an income for the Trust. Income which is paid for by our residents who have no alternative but to use such numbers, after all, they can hardly take their business somewhere else.
